Well thank you, it was a fine show. Very nice race track lots of high speed steeply banked curves. I probably had the slowest vehicle in the show but you would not have know it the way it charged down to the start-finish line for photos with the other winners after all the spectators and other participants had left

I must say that changing out the 30-35 year old nylon tube tires to modern radials has transformed the rover. I kind of hated to change them they suited the rover and were still in perfect condition, lots of thread left no checking and probably would have gone another 30 years, but the flat spots were kind of annoying after it sat over night. It steers beautifully (for a rover) the vibrations are gone and it is almost silent (again for a rover).
